A man called Kalispell police to his Bluestone Drive residence because his daughter was out of control. He managed to contain her to her room, but also noticed two large kitchen knives were missing. The knives were found outside the bedroom and officers counseled the parties involved.

A 19-year-old man wanted on a felony warrant was recognized at a casino on North Main Street. He was arrested for the warrant and drug possession.

A First Avenue West woman's son was supposed to drive his sister to a doctor's appointment. Instead he took off in her car to go visit a friend.

A man approached a 9-year-old boy near a school on Third Avenue West, prompting the scared child to run all the way home.

A 48-year-old woman was arrested for trespassing on Eighth Avenue East. A complaint was filed after she kept returning to an apartment from which she had been evicted.

An 18-year-old man was arrested behind the police station on a warrant for traffic violations. He aroused officers' suspicions when he bolted upon seeing them.

A 7-year-old was pushed in the snow near a Third Avenue West School.

The inside of Fifth Street West home was vandalized.

A 42-year-old man was arrested for driving under the influence of alcohol and without insurance during a traffic stop on Second Street East.

Officers were charged by vicious pit bulls in Woodland Park. They cited a 23-year-old woman and a 20-year-old woman for loose and vicious dogs.

A Fifth Avenue West North resident saw a man in a hooded sweatshirt rummaging through his truck and tried to chase him down.

Someone hit a fence on Second Avenue East North.

Officers responded to a domestic disturbance on Fifth Avenue East and separated the parties involved.

A 20-year-old man was arrested on a warrant for bail jumping when officers stopped him for skateboarding on city streets.
